Philippians 4:13 - "I can do all things through Christ who strengthens me."

Context: Paul speaks about contentment and reliance on God's strength.
Encouragement: Trust in Christ's strength to overcome any challenge this week.
Proverbs 3:5-6 - "Trust in the Lord with all your heart, and lean not on your own understanding; in all your ways submit to him, and he will make your paths straight."

Context: Solomon advises on wisdom and guidance.
Encouragement: Rely on God’s wisdom and direction for success in all your endeavors.
Jeremiah 29:11 - "'For I know the plans I have for you,' declares the Lord, 'plans to prosper you and not to harm you, plans to give you hope and a future.'"

Context: God's promise to the Israelites during their exile.
Encouragement: Have faith in God's good plans for your prosperity and future.
Psalm 37:4-5 - "Take delight in the Lord, and he will give you the desires of your heart. Commit your way to the Lord; trust in him and he will do this."

Context: David’s advice on finding joy and commitment in God.
Encouragement: Delight and trust in the Lord, and He will fulfill your heart’s desires.
Matthew 6:33 - "But seek first his kingdom and his righteousness, and all these things will be given to you as well."

Context: Jesus teaches about priorities and trust in God.
Encouragement: Prioritize God’s kingdom, and He will take care of your needs.
Joshua 1:9 - "Have I not commanded you? Be strong and courageous. Do not be afraid; do not be discouraged, for the Lord your God will be with you wherever you go."

Context: God’s encouragement to Joshua as he leads the Israelites.
Encouragement: Be courageous and strong, knowing God is with you in every challenge.
Romans 8:28 - "And we know that in all things God works for the good of those who love him, who have been called according to his purpose."

Context: Paul’s assurance of God’s sovereignty and goodness.
Encouragement: Trust that God is working everything for your good, according to His purpose.
Reading and meditating on these scriptures can provide guidance, strength, and encouragement as you navigate the challenges and opportunities of this week.

By incorporating these practices into your life, you will grow closer to Jesus and strengthen your spiritual journey.

Prayer and Communication: Regular prayer is crucial for a strong relationship with Jesus. Philippians 4:6 says, "Do not be anxious about anything, but in every situation, by prayer and petition, with thanksgiving, present your requests to God." Make prayer a daily habit to deepen your connection with Christ.

Bible Study: Engaging with Scripture helps you understand God’s will. 2 Timothy 3:16-17 states, "All Scripture is God-breathed and is useful for teaching, rebuking, correcting, and training in righteousness, so that the servant of God may be thoroughly equipped for every good work."

Obedience to God’s Word: Live according to Biblical principles. James 1:22 encourages, "Do not merely listen to the word, and so deceive yourselves. Do what it says."

Worship: Worship fosters a deeper love and reverence for God. John 4:24 says, "God is spirit, and his worshipers must worship in the Spirit and in truth." Participate in worship regularly to honor God.

Fellowship with Believers: Surround yourself with a community of faith. Hebrews 10:24-25 advises, "And let us consider how we may spur one another on toward love and good deeds, not giving up meeting together, as some are in the habit of doing, but encouraging one another."

Service to Others: Follow Jesus’ example by serving others. Mark 10:45 reminds us, "For even the Son of Man did not come to be served, but to serve, and to give his life as a ransom for many."

Living by the Spirit: Allow the Holy Spirit to guide your actions. Galatians 5:16 instructs, "So I say, walk by the Spirit, and you will not gratify the desires of the flesh." Living by the Spirit brings you closer to Jesus.
